**Q: How do I get into the bike cage and through the parking gates?**

A: The bike cage at Thornbury House sits behind Parking Gate B. Your staff badge opens Gate A automatically once HR activates it, usually within two working days of your start date. Gate B and the cage itself use a shared keypad instead of badge readers, so new starters should memorise the code rather than writing it on anything kept with their bike. The current keypad code is shown below.

door code, fawip-yagef: bdg-NPIWQ-43434

MEMO — Franchise Agreement, Bramblewood Coffee Co.

Team — quick update before Friday's call. The franchise terms with the Orvale group are basically settled: seven-year initial term, territory covering the Hallet Bay corridor, standard royalty tiers. They pushed back on the marketing levy and we split the difference, so don't be surprised when you see the revised schedule. Training obligations sit with us for year one. Keep this out of client conversations for now. The confidential note below explains where this fits in our wider plans.

confidential, kagep-kahof: Druokax Systems plans to lower the Ulaath list price by 53 percent in March.

## EXIF Scrubbing — Upload Pipeline (Brightmoor)

Before any user image reaches persistent storage, the scrubber worker must strip all EXIF blocks, including GPS, serial number, and maker notes. Verify the scrub by running the validation job against the quarantine bucket; zero residual tags is the only passing state. If validation fails, halt the pipeline and page the media team — do not requeue manually. Step-by-step recovery instructions are on the internal page below.

runbook for badug-kadup: https://confluence.zemvarlabs.internal/projects/browse/display/projects/bd1b

Hi all — quick heads-up for the finance team on the insurance renewal. Our policy with Caldstone Mutual comes up next month and the first quote landed about 9% higher than last year. We're pushing back and getting a rival quote from Ambervale. Budget holders, please pencil in the higher figure for now just in case. Background on why this matters is below.

confidential, yahip-hagug: Gorixax Logistics plans to lower the Ulaael list price by 26.6 percent in October. The pricing group signed off on a budget of $199.9 million for Project Holix. The renewal with Kasdorox Systems closes at $137.5 million a year, 8.2 percent above the last contract. Project Lamion slips by a full year because of the audit delay.